Output dd9617fbade0821d3c765174835480edb7046b8de76138e808784935f00be6a0:0

value
64368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6c109894299b7a039b764f882cd619259b01a8e OP_EQUAL
address
3MGXn4MyhRkaJar4qQLfJxhWD5kZfFn8Ae
transaction
dd9617fbade0821d3c765174835480edb7046b8de76138e808784935f00be6a0
spent
true